Media Sera and Reagents Cell Culture Market Overview: Size and Growth Projections (Global & Regional Insights):

This market includes essential components used in the growth, maintenance, and differentiation of cultured cells in research, vaccine production, biopharmaceuticals, and regenerative medicine. It encompasses basal media, sera (like FBS), supplements, antibiotics, and reagents. Increasing demand from cell-based therapies, vaccine development, and tissue engineering is driving strong market expansion across pharmaceutical, biotech, and academic labs.

Evolving Landscape of AI in the Media Sera and Reagents Cell Culture in Healthcare Industry

AI is optimizing media formulations, predicting cell line behavior, and enabling real-time monitoring of growth conditions. It accelerates the identification of nutrient requirements and automates batch quality control by learning from high-throughput experiments.

Emerging AI Technologies Driving the Media Sera and Reagents Cell Culture Market Forward

Key AI applications include automated cell viability prediction, machine learning-guided media design, and real-time image-based culture monitoring. AI also supports data-driven process control in large-scale biomanufacturing using sensor data.

Key Trends Shaping the Future of AI in the Media Sera and Reagents Cell Culture Market

Trends include serum-free and animal-free media growth, use of AI to support 3D and organoid culture systems, increasing demand for customizable reagent kits, and shift toward single-use bioprocessing components.

Considerations and Challenges for AI in the Media Sera and Reagents Cell Culture industry

Key challenges involve raw material variability (especially in serum), high production costs, contamination risk, and the need for scalable, reproducible formulations for clinical-grade products.
